USN-8615-1 Not scored

linux, linux-aws, linux-aws-5.4, linux-aws-fips, linux-azure, linux-azure-5.4, linux-azure-fips, linux-bluefield, linux-fips, linux-gcp, linux-gcp-5.4, linux-gcp-fips, linux-hwe-5.4, linux-iot, linux-oracle, linux-oracle-5.4, linux-xilinx-zynqmp vulnerabilities

It was discovered that a logic flaw existed in the XFRM ESP-in-TCP subsystem in the Linux kernel when handling socket buffer fragments. This flaw is known as Fragnesia. A local attacker could use this to escalate privileges, or possibly escape a container. (CVE-2026-43503) Several security issues were discovered in the Linux kernel. An attacker could possibly use these to compromise the system. This update corrects flaws in the following subsystems: - InfiniBand drivers; - STMicroelectronics network drivers; - NVME drivers; - SCSI subsystem; - USB over IP driver; - Network file system (NFS) server daemon; - SMB network file system; - Tracing infrastructure; - B.A.T.M.A.N. meshing protocol; - Ethernet bridge; - Ceph Core library; - IPv4 networking; - IPv6 networking; - Netfilter; - RxRPC session sockets; - X.25 network layer; (CVE-2026-23272, CVE-2026-23455, CVE-2026-31402, CVE-2026-31418, CVE-2026-31607, CVE-2026-31637, CVE-2026-31649, CVE-2026-31659, CVE-2026-31682, CVE-2026-31685, CVE-2026-43011, CVE-2026-43037, CVE-2026-43038, CVE-2026-43117, CVE-2026-43383, CVE-2026-43407, CVE-2026-43414, CVE-2026-45988, CVE-2026-46043, CVE-2026-46119, CVE-2026-46135, CVE-2026-46243)
